Dr. Chan's lab is focused on computational cancer genomics, cancer evolution, and p53 biology. We develop computational tools and pipelines for analyzing, integrating, and modeling immense biological data, including genome, transcriptome, DNA methylation, single-cell genomics, and precision oncology.
